Output 656507fa50fe9c8caee167f5e6ea209eec1526adcf73cb9df3cb011cc6e822d7:1

value
157496850
script pubkey
OP_0 OP_PUSHBYTES_20 3dfdc4b0364cb09f84f910193e9a2a8967233f83
address
ltc1q8h7ufvpkfjcflp8ezqvnax3239njx0urgh5d5g
transaction
656507fa50fe9c8caee167f5e6ea209eec1526adcf73cb9df3cb011cc6e822d7
spent
true